    Question

    Two pipes A and B can fill a tank in 15 hours and 20

    hours, respectively. Another pipe C can empty the tank in 30 hours. If all three pipes are opened together, how long will it take to fill the tank?
    A 12 hours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    B 15 hours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    C 18 hours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    D 14 hours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

    Solution

    Work done by A in 1 hour = 1/15. Work done by B in 1 hour = 1/20. Work done by C (emptying) in 1 hour = βˆ’1/30. Net work done in 1 hour = 1/15 + 1/20 βˆ’ 1/30. LCM of 15, 20, and 30 is 60. Net work done in 1 hour = (4 + 3 βˆ’ 2)/60 = 5/60 = 1/12. Time taken to fill the tank = 12 hours. Thus, the correct answer is 12 hours . Ans. a
